Output 69535cd8c97d39cc09c5df5cf92f54570fc7eda23dc70b6b1f3e332fa8496ffe:2

value
2353368
script pubkey
OP_0 OP_PUSHBYTES_20 3bbd34ee7f49c330c8da8dcfd0895ea5fb723315
address
ltc1q8w7nfmnlf8pnpjx63h8apz275hahyvc44zfty8
transaction
69535cd8c97d39cc09c5df5cf92f54570fc7eda23dc70b6b1f3e332fa8496ffe
spent
true